Here is a look at what guests can expect with the reopening of LEGOLAND Florida Resort on June 1, 2020:
PLANNING
Guests are encouraged to download the LEGOLAND mobile app and review the website in advance of their arrival, for a full outline of the parks’ new arrival and attractions procedures, as well as details on the enhanced cleaning measures.
Tickets and vacations should be booked in advance online, when possible.
Guests should be prepared to make on-site payments using a credit or debit card as cash will no longer be accepted on property. Guests experiencing any symptoms related to COVID-19 should refrain from visiting the Resort.
ARRIVAL
At the time of reopening, the Park will operate at 50 percent of its capacity.
If guests are arriving by car, they should expect to leave spaces in between vehicles and follow additional spacing instructions.
All park employees and guests will be required to undergo non-invasive temperature checks. Those with a temperature of 100.4 F will not be allowed entry, nor will those in their party.
THROUGH THE RESORT
Every employee at LEGOLAND will wear a facial covering, and we will provide complimentary masks to encourage all our guests, ages three and above, to do the same.
Brick-themed spatial markers and kid-friendly, parkwide signage will help remind guests of social distancing recommendations and hygiene practices.
More than 200 hand sanitizing stations have been added throughout the park. Guests can view these locations on the LEGOLAND mobile app while traversing the park.
Character meet and greets and other select attractions will be suspended at the time of reopening.
Enhanced cleaning measures throughout the day will disinfect high-frequency touchpoints, including ride restraints, tables and chairs, service counters, handles and door handles.
Guests will also see enhancements in our mobile app over the coming weeks that will allow them to reserve their spot in queue lines for major attractions directly from their own devices.

Families can craft their vacation by selecting any of the three LEGOLAND Florida Resort hotels, including LEGOLAND Florida Hotel, LEGOLAND Beach Retreat, and the all-new Pirate Island Hotel, opening April 17.
Located just 130 kid-steps from the theme park entrance, LEGOLAND Pirate Island Hotel will feature 150 LEGO-filled rooms (including four suites), a heated pool (complete with LEGO soft bricks to build in the pool), hundreds of LEGO models, exclusive character experiences and in-room LEGO treasure hunts. Similar to the popular LEGOLAND Hotel, each room will include two separate spaces: a kid’s sleeping area and an adult area.
The five-story hotel will house the pirate-themed Shipwreck Restaurant with family-style dining, Smuggler’s Bar for adult swashbucklers, an entertainment area with kid-friendly nightly programming and LEGO play areas. Directly outside the entrance to the hotel, a pirate shipwreck will greet guests and offer a unique photo opportunity.

All-New Experiences at Universal Orlando Resort will Bring the Darker Side of the Wizarding World– including Death Eaters – to Life in Hogsmeade on Select Nights Through November 15
As darkness falls on select nights starting September 14 the all-consuming Dark Arts will be unleashed in Hogsmeade when the all-new light projection experience, Dark Arts at Hogwarts Castle, will make its highly-anticipated debut at Universal’s Islands of Adventure at the Universal Orlando Resort.
The nighttime show utilizing state-of-the-art projection mapping, special effects and lighting to bring a new dimension of magic to life on the majestic Hogwarts castle.
But before the experience, an ominous green light and fog will permeate the village, signaling the arrival of the Death Eaters. They’ll eerily roam throughout Hogsmeade, lurking amongst guests – practicing the Dark Arts with complete disregard of wizarding laws.
This marks the first time that guests at Universal Orlando will be able to encounter Death Eaters – devoted followers of Lord Voldemort known for their allegiance and practice of the Dark Arts – as part of their experience in The Wizarding World of Harry Potter – Hogsmeade.
As the Dark Arts at Hogwarts Castle begins Hogwarts Castle is illuminated with a darker side of the wizarding world sinister creatures and villains – such as Dementors, Aragog, Mountain Trolls, Thestrals and more – cloak the castle through a mesmerizing display of light, music and special effects.
To help battle these dark forces, guests will be asked to summon their inner strength and bravely face the Dark Arts and the visage of the powerful Dark wizard Lord Voldemort, until the Patronus spell – to cast one of the most famous, difficult and powerful defense of the Dark Arts charms in the wizarding world.
The highly anticipated Dark Arts at Hogwarts Castle will run select nights through November 15 in The Wizarding World of Harry Potter – Hogsmeade at Universal’s Islands of Adventure.
